The crew of a 1989 CT56 sails from the C&D Canal through the Delaware Bay toward Cape May, New Jersey.2:15 To avoid a close-hauled, uncomfortable point of sail, the crew motors for the first five miles before turning to run downwind, where they deploy the genoa and mizzen.3:41 The vessel maintains speeds over 8 knots with the help of a favorable current.4:58 During the transit, the host addresses a recurring issue with water in the fuel system, identifying condensation caused by an air conditioning vent leaking cold air directly onto the metal diesel fill tube.7:04 He resolves the problem by sealing the gaps in the vent box with marine caulking to prevent further condensation.8:03 The crew uses iPads synced via Wi-Fi to the chart plotter to monitor navigation and depth while relaxing on deck.8:44 Upon arrival in Cape May, the crew meets a local friend for dinner before returning to the boat ahead of incoming rain.11:22
